The truth was a bitter thing, especially when it came to Lyra. The kings that sat in front of me wouldn't be able to hear it entirely, that much I knew. I looked down at the carpet as I began the horror story that Lyra's mates wanted to hear.
It was 13 years ago that we found Lyra, or she found us. I was in South Carolina with Esme, we had been thinking of moving there temporarily and were brushing up on the details of our new home. It was late at night when we heard our new neighbours leaving their house. I heard her then. There were faint whimpers and cries coming from the house.
All through that night those voices haunted me, but Esme and I knew we couldn't risk trying to find out who it was. We were meant to leave the following morning but we stayed, I wasn't sure why but we did. Our neighbour came back in the late afternoon when it was around 5pm. We could smell the alcohol that stained whoever it was' clothes. We could hear the cries getting louder, multiple objects crashed. I decided to get up and see what was happening, but that was when we heard the voice.
Esme cringed. I fell to the ground as the voice got louder in my head. It wasn't saying anything decipherable, rather screaming help, stop and please. The voices quietened down after a few more minutes. I looked up to see a pale Esme looking over at me. Rather than saying anything we both nodded, exiting the house we were in. The smell of blood hit us as soon as we stepped up to the doorstep of the house next door. Without thinking I snapped the door handle and opened the door.
The house was in a state of severe disarray, the smell of alcohol lingering with the blood. I ran into the room where I could smell the blood, that's when I saw her. There was a little girl, the source of the blood, cowering into the corner. There was another person in the room, a man, sprawled out on the floor. The girl noticed me and pushed herself deeper into the wall.

"Hello," I whispered but in the dead of the room, I might as well have been shouting. The girl began crying. I walked over to her. "I hurt daddy," she sobbed. "Shh bunny you're going to be okay," I gently picked her up but she still winced. Esme had been watching from the doorway, a look of pure horror on her face. I looked into the girl's eyes and felt something shift. A soul bond formed. Esme felt it as well, as venomous tears formed in her eyes.
The kings all looked shaken. "We took her in and from then on she's been with us. What you saw today was her mind-link. She has the ability to create these monstrous voices when she's scared, it's similar to Jane's gift, only it works more with fear than it does with pain." Aro nodded at me. "Lyra herself doesn't remember much of her past, but get's these flashbacks, as you saw the other day."
"Can she control it?" Aro seemed the least shaken of the three. I shook my head answering his question.
I sighed and rubbed my forehead, "I need for all three of you to know that I am regretful for what happened today. As kings it is your decision what you want to do with Edward, my family will not get in your way."
What Carlisle had told us was definitely not the whole story, but that was probably for the best. I blinked away the venom that had gathered at the edges of my eyes.
"As much as I would love to rip your son-" I began, "is no longer a son of mine" Carlisle growled. "Well as much as I'd love to rip him into a million pieces, my brothers and I have decided that we will not do anything of the sort." Carlisle looked surprised at this. "Although, it will be for the best if you oust him from your coven Carlisle,"
Advertisement
"Consider it done." Carlisle hesitated, "there is one more thing I'd like to speak to you about".
"Go on".
"You should take Lyra with you to Volterra, tomorrow morning. Before you question my motives, it is only because I want her to be safe and she'll be safest with you and the guard. After what happened today with Edward I don't think she is safe here. It will be best if you leave before the boy repeats any of his foolish mistakes." Carlisle tried hiding his concern, but we could tell it wasn't just Lyra's wellbeing he was thinking about.
All three of us must've looked either confused or suspecting, because Carlisle was quick to defend himself. "Will Lyra agree? I'm sorry Carlisle but we will not ask our mate to do anything she is not prepared for," Caius said looking offended. I understood what he meant, though the thought of Lyra moving in with us did excite me, these things took time and Lyra had already been through enough.
"I will speak to her in the morning, I'm sure she will understand," Carlisle's tone was firm. "In that case I'll go prepare the guard," there was a hint of delight in Marcus' voice. I desperately wanted to ask Carlisle if I could use my tactile telepathy, but I knew that it would be best if the rest of the story came from Lyra herself.
Both me and Caius stepped up to help Marcus prepare when I remembered something. "Carlisle, you wouldn't perhaps know what Lyra's favourite colour is would you?" Carlisle mustered a tired smile and raised his eyebrow, "red". I grinned in delight as Caius scowled, "red it is then".
